STATEMENT FOR TH*! PHSSS St. 5243 Federal Reserve Board, January 22, 1927. pleased for publication Sunday morning, Jan. 23; not earlier. BANK DEBITS Debits to individual accounts, as reported to the Federal Reserve Boai*d by banks in leading cities for the week ending January 19 , 1927. aggregated $1 3 , 552 , 000,000 or 3 .2 per cent above the total of $1 3 , 129 ,000,000 reported for the preceding week. Total debits for the week under review axe $25,000,000 or .6 per cent below those for the week ending January 20, 1926. Hew York City reported an increase of $61,000,000 and Los Angeles an increase of $25,000,000, while Chicago and Pittsburgh reported reductions of $4-2,000,000 and $23 , 000 , 000 , respectively. Aggregate debits for l4l centers for which figures have been published weekly since January 1919 amounted to about $12,752,000,000 as compared with $1 2 , 306 , 605,000 for the preceding week and $12,840,313,000 for the week ending January 20, 1926 . __________ DEBITS TO INDIVIDUAL ACCOUNTS B?
